🚧 wip: chekkupointo, far from complete

This commit is contained in:
2026-02-27 01:57:27 +01:00
parent 2a338f251e
commit 9cce47908f
26 changed files with 476 additions and 810 deletions
+2 -6
View File
@@ -6,7 +6,6 @@
#include "Core/Config/manager.hpp"
#include "Core/Image/model.hpp"
#include "Core/Image/provider.hpp"
#include "Core/Palette/data.hpp"
#include "Core/Palette/manager.hpp"
#include "Core/Service/manager.hpp"
@@ -33,14 +32,11 @@ int main(int argc, char* argv[]) {
QQmlApplicationEngine engine;
auto* imageProvider = new Image::Provider();
engine.addImageProvider(QLatin1String("processed"), imageProvider);
auto config = new Config::Manager(
Utils::getConfigDir(),
s_options.appendDirs,
s_options.configPath,
imageProvider);
&engine);
qmlRegisterSingletonInstance(
COREMODULE_URI,
MODULE_VERSION_MAJOR,
@@ -49,8 +45,8 @@ int main(int argc, char* argv[]) {
config);
auto imageModel = new Image::Model(
*imageProvider,
config->getSortConfig(),
Utils::getCacheDir(),
config->getFocusImageSize(),
config);
qmlRegisterSingletonInstance(